Job Description

At Whitman, Requardt & Associates, LLP, we are "People Focused and Project Driven". We have been in business for more than 110 years and we are known for our quality work and quality employees. This is your chance to join our team - help us to design the infrastructure and buildings that improve the world!

We are currently seeking a highly motivated Marketing/Administrative Assistant to coordinate and produce proposals, presentations, brochures, and other marketing collateral as well as perform administrative and office support activities. This position will provide support to multiple people and offices.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to, reviewing requests for proposals to determine the required format, information, and approach to meeting proposal specifications. In addition, the candidate will coordinate with the graphics team, project manager, and project team to create the elements of the proposal for submission to the client. Must be well organized, detail oriented, high energy, and responsive with excellent writing and proofreading skills.

In addition, the candidate will need to support word processing, report formatting, filing, and other office support duties.
